Re/sound: Songs of Wisconsin – Authentic, Cultural Resources

February 6, 2023 By dmenk

WSMA in partnership with PBS Wisconsin Education have created cultural resources for use in your classroom, your performance group rehearsals or your own educational growth. In Re/sound: Songs of Wisconsin performers from across Wisconsin share a composition, a performance, the story behind the music and the role of music in their own lives. Educator guides for classroom use as well as extended resource lists are provided for each performer’s work. Make use of these valuable resources:

  • Composer Performances and Interviews
  • Educator Guides
  • Online Resources
  • Interview and Workshop Recordings

SEL  Connected Re/sound Lesson Resources Cindy Bourget created social emotional learning resources created for each of the Re/sound lessons. Outcomes, strategies, plan and assessments from the SEL educator guides were shared. Take advantage of this opportunity to work with the resources prepared by a WSCA award winning school counselor!

An educational collaboration by WSMA and PBS Wisconsin Education

Re/sound: Songs of Wisconsin
In a state-wide survey and listening sessions with music educators, we learned about the need for current, authentic, culturally diverse resources, as well as support in teaching with and about music from different cultures. This multimedia collection for general music programs serving grades 4-8 includes video interviews with Wisconsin musicians, performances, audio files, and educator engagement guides designed to help activate the media with learners.
